Output 59bf7541fdcfa727b5324f86a91c2a7301ace9876f4a94838bf73b73363f201e:1

value
9398992
script pubkey
OP_0 OP_PUSHBYTES_20 e03a1b2906ab9621028c5920294de3c19bea012f
address
ltc1quqapk2gx4wtzzq5vtyszjn0rcxd75qf0s8q8l7
transaction
59bf7541fdcfa727b5324f86a91c2a7301ace9876f4a94838bf73b73363f201e
spent
true